AviSense Recognised Among the Finalists of the 15th NBG Business Seeds Innovation & Technology Competition
AviSense has been recognised among the distinguished finalists of the 15th NBG Business Seeds Innovation & Technology Competition, receiving a Distinction for its work in Extended Reality, Artificial Intelligence and real-time situational awareness for safer mobility.
AviSense is proud to announce its distinction in the 15th NBG Business Seeds Innovation & Technology Competition, one of Greece’s most established initiatives supporting innovation, technology-driven entrepreneurship and startup growth.
The competition, organised by the National Bank of Greece through the NBG Business Seeds programme, brings together innovative companies and research-driven teams developing solutions with strong technological, business and societal potential. The 15th edition highlighted startups active across advanced technologies and AI, digital entrepreneurship, fintech, ESG, energy, environment and other high-impact sectors.
AviSense was selected among the companies that reached the final evaluation phase of the competition and received a Distinction for its work on XR-based solutions that enhance road safety, situational awareness and the operational efficiency of connected and autonomous mobility systems.
This recognition reflects the core mission of AviSense: to transform fragmented visual, geospatial and sensor data into real-time intelligence that helps people, operators and intelligent systems understand complex environments and act faster with confidence.
Our technology combines Artificial Intelligence, Augmented Reality, real-time geolocation and environmental analysis to support safer decision-making in dynamic environments. By visualising hidden risks, improving perception beyond the direct line of sight and delivering explainable information in real time, AviSense contributes to the development of safer, more trustworthy and more human-centred mobility systems.
